Output 3e3926649ffe27dde99df5dde2846861a6c0ed58794e9df175c46b73c9a6a0d3:5

value
14912501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40b33601e2317753bcba669545ada1ce740eb810 OP_EQUAL
address
37b7rckH5KWkAp8zitB1ng7ZWA9cFzr3Yf
transaction
3e3926649ffe27dde99df5dde2846861a6c0ed58794e9df175c46b73c9a6a0d3
spent
true